Channels in Marketo are specifically classified as tags. Imagine tags as a way to categorize your marketing assets, helping you to cleanly organize and track performance across different marketing campaigns. Think about it, you’ve got emails, social media posts, webinars—each one could create a whirlpool of data. By tagging assets with relevant channels, you create a well-organized library that lets you see at a glance which channels are resonating with your audience. Pretty neat, right?

To break it down further, let’s say you’ve got a marketing campaign featuring a webinar. By assigning “webinar” as a channel tag, you can easily segment all related assets. This makes it straightforward to analyze engagement levels across different channels, like social media or email, leading to optimization based on data rather than guesswork.
